3RL9

Crystal Structure of the complex of type I RIP with the hydrolyzed product of dATP, adenine at 1.9 A resolution

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sESRF BEAMLINE BM14
Synchrotron siteESRF
BeamlineBM14
Temperature [K]77
Detector technologyCCD
Collection date2010-05-13
DetectorMARRESEARCH
Wavelength(s)0.97
Spacegroup nameH 3
Unit cell lengths130.019, 130.019, 39.620
Unit cell angles90.00, 90.00, 120.00
Refinement procedure
Resolution29.000 - 1.900
R-factor0.19998
Rwork0.198
R-free0.23778
Structure solution methodMOLECULAR REPLACEMENT
Starting model (for MR)1aha
RMSD bond length0.006
RMSD bond angle0.865
Data reduction softwareMOSFLM
Data scaling softwareSCALEPACK
Phasing softwareAMoRE
Refinement softwareREFMAC (5.5.0109)
Data quality characteristics
 OverallOuter shell
Low resolution limit [Å]65.0001.950
High resolution limit [Å]1.9001.900
Number of reflections18659
<I/σ(I)>15.44.1
Completeness [%]99.999.2
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, HANGING DROP6.729814% PEG 6000, 0.1M Sodium Phosphate , pH 6.7 , VAPOR DIFFUSION, HANGING DROP, temperature 298 K
